Quality is an imperative part of life. Without it, you’d just stall or lag. What happens when you shop online and don’t get the quality you expect? Get disappointed when you order your favorite food and it does not taste the same as it appeared?
The examples of quality mismatch are countless. Quality is paramount to govern the sustainability of a product or service. The principles and the rules are just the same for the Software Industry, as well.
Meeting the quality parameters has become a lot more significant in the post-pandemic era now. Staying connected, and adapting to the digital environment is no longer a choice, it is a compulsion.
This shift had businesses, especially, in the software domain, to become more agile and quality-driven. Quality Engineering, thus, has taken the center stage.
Quality Engineering (QE) governance has become more integrated into the software development lifecycle (SDLC) with the rise of Agile and DevOps. The goal is to maintain a quality standard at the product level.
What has changed in Quality Engineering Post-Pandemic
The Quality Engineer governance team plays the most important role where project managers, team leads, and product owners combined make quality control strategies. As a result, they introduce new processes, tools, and technologies that enhance overall product quality and enhance organizational effectiveness
Quality Benchmarks: Keep on testing until you are satisfied
Maintaining an edge in quality, software testing has adopted an agile and DevOps approach to embracing the idea of shift-left. This has enabled the faster detection of bugs affecting the product quality, timely release, cost-saving, and many more benefits. The testing cycles are multiple and the quest to quality is higher.
Greater Number of Platforms to Test – Greater Flexibility in Teams
. During the pandemic, remote working brought with it the challenges to testing in a greater number of end-user platforms and it demanded more flexibility in processes and practices.
Improved Quality and Management Inputs
Testing now has to be less time-consuming and resource-intensive. However, this approach runs the risk of employees drifting away from the new QE processes as they become accustomed to the new mindset. Positively, the governance function of QE is responsible for detecting and correcting deviations from the agreed QE approach.
Higher Need for Data-Driven Quality Improvements
A software quality engineer investigates the relationship between project characteristics, project metrics, and the end product’s quality. When these findings are understood, the organization can engineer improvements to the process as well as the product. After obtaining software metrics, these measurements can be used for quality assurance, performance, debugging, management, and cost estimation.
More the testing volume, the better the results
Digital transformation and flexible software are becoming increasingly valued by organizations and their employees. In turn, quality engineers have more work to do. Here the software testing tools can streamline the minutiae of a test run and help track the status of a portfolio of testing efforts. This has enabled the quality engineers to manage the efforts simultaneously reducing the manual work. This also ensures the robust performance of systems with improved load time. Make sure you are doing uninterrupted testing and providing better results.
Speed and quality now a greater priority
No matter whether you are working from home or office, quality needs to be maintained. This stands important in every industry and here QEs have an outstanding role to play. Quality and speed are in demand and therefore companies have to prioritize them with experts with good level experience and the leading industry tools. Your quality engineering partner can automate and machine learn your tests while maintaining quality, and, more importantly, not compromising your brand’s reputation, with technologies such as automation, machine learning, and artificial intelligence.
Keeping competition behind
The software industry is facing neck-to-neck competition where maintaining quality is the only way to sustain and stand out from the crowd. Quality engineering will help meet the customer’s demands by bringing out cost-effective solutions at a lesser price and with minimal manual work. This is how the digital environment will stay. But the industry is full of reckless competition where your organization has to be prepared to cross all the obstacles meeting the demand with industry-leading tools, training, and processes and staying ahead in this testing world.
It is time organizations begin to self-evaluate and honestly answer this – as to how prepared they are, in terms of meeting the ever-evolving demand for quality, training, modern tools and industry-leading deliveries.
This is an area where we can help extend your teams and stand by your side as a tower of support in Testing. Reach us through comments.
About the Author
Written by Infiwave Solutions